GRAŽIŠKIAI
County : Marijampolė
Municipality : Vilkaviškis
Lithuanian | blazon wanted |
English | blazon wanted |
Origin/meaning
The arms were officially granted on December 10, 2001.
The arms mentions the local variation of Lithuanian customs of Shrovetide: Syvis, one of characters of traditional masquerade. This character is not known elsewhere in Lithuania (most likely it came to Graziskiai from Poland).
